Mount Kilimanjaro is the tallest mountain in Africa, rising about 5,895 m (19,341 feet) above the sea level. It is located in Tanzania, where it forms part of Kilimanjaro National Park. Mount Kilimanjaro has three main volcanic cones, namely Kibo, Mawenzi, and Shira.

Locals named the highest point of the mountain Wagagai. Wagagai is entirely in Uganda and is the tallest peak. Mt. Elgon is a shield volcano. Geologists believe it is the oldest in East Africa. Like other mountains in Africa, Mt Elgon has five peaks. They include: Wagagai, Sudek, Koitobos, Mubiyi, and Masaba.

Mount Elgon was once Africa's highest mountain. However, due to erosion it lost its record height. It last erupted 10 million years ago and is an extinct volcano. Mount Elgon has the largest volcanic base in the world at 2,500 square miles (4,000 square kilometers) and 50 miles (80 kilometers) in diameter.

Mount Kenya is the highest mountain in Kenya and the second-highest mountain in Africa. The mountain is located in the east-central part of the country, about 87 miles north-northeast of the capital Nairobi. Like Kilimanjaro, Mount Kenya is a stratovolcano that consists of three distinct peaks: Batian, Nelion, and Point Lenana.
